NEW
Showing 1477–1488 of 4684 results
-
GERMAN SPORT FIREFLY .22LR
$246.94 Add to cart -
GERMAN SPORT FIREFLY .22LR
$249.54 Add to cart -
GERMAN SPORT FIREFLY .22LR
$249.54 Add to cart -
GERMAN SPORT FIREFLY .22LR
$249.54 Add to cart -
GERMAN SPORT FIREFLY .22LR
$249.54 Add to cart -
GERMAN SPORT GSG-16 .22LR
$350.99 Read more -
GERMAN SPORT GSG-16 .22LR
$350.99 Read more -
GERMAN SPORT GSG-16 .22LR
$350.99 Read more -
GERMAN SPORT GSG-16 .22LR
$383.44 Add to cart -
GERMAN SPORT MP40P PISTOL
Read more -
GIRSAN MC1911 10MM CARRY
$699.00 Read more -
GIRSAN MC1911 10MM CARRY
$679.00 Add to cart